IMA Conference on Mathematics of the Climate System

Date: Tuesday 13 - Thursday 15 September 2011
Location: University of Reading

This conference will be about the construction and use of mathematical and computational models of the climate system, from the conceptual to the comprehensive. The conceptual models aid our understanding of how certain climate processes interact, and enable us to assess, interpret and diagnose the comprehensive models. Also, the conceptual models provide readily understandable paradigms for dynamical climate-system behaviour, which may be tested in the comprehensive models.
The conference will focus on four related topics:

  1. Extraction of deterministic and stochastic models from measurements and simulations of the climate system;
  2. Reduced complexity models and their dynamics;
  3. Confronting scientific hypotheses about the climate system with data;
  4. Mathematically-based diagnostic studies of climate dynamics and statistics based on comprehensive models and reanalyses.
